Learn the basics of woodworking during this 1-day introductory workshop. We’ll walk you through the basics of working with wood, hand and power tools and you’ll discover the joy of woodworking as you complete a take-home project. We’ll go over the major shop tools (jointer, planer, table-saw, chop-saw, router, bandsaw), show you how to use them safely and discuss what to consider when buying tools from santa maria signs and advertising their business. Each participant will build a unique cutting board and we’ll go over wood finishing products and all the non-toxic, healthy options out there.
